复利计算再升级------------------------------------------------------------
客户在大家的引导下,有了更多的想法:
- 这个数据我经常会填.....帮我预先填上呗?......
- 把界面做得简单漂亮好操作一点呗?
- 能不能帮我转成个APP,我装到手机上就更方便了?
- 我觉得这个很有用,很多人可能都需要这些功能,做到我的微信公众号上吧?
- 能不能不要让我填表单,让我发条消息,或者对着手机说句话就可以了?
每组选一两个方向加以改进,让我们的投资计算与记录工具,达到可以发布给用户使用的版本,并发布博客对此次更新进行说明与总结。
截止日期:2016.4.14晚11点。
周五的时候同学们相互观看与评价。
结对同学:甄增文-201406114233
博客地址: http://home.cnblogs.com/u/zhenzengwen/
利用了SetConsoleTextAttribute()函数进行了界面的更新
void main()
{
HANDLE handle = GetStdHandle(STD_OUTPUT_HANDLE); // 获取控制台句柄
while(1){
int num=7;
duqu();
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_RED | FOREGROUND_GREEN | FOREGROUND_BLUE);
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" \n");
printf(" -------------------------------------\n");
printf(" | 欢迎来到广州商业银行 |\n");
printf(" | 顾客你可以根据0~7选择 |\n");
printf(" | 0.清空动态显示 |\n");
SetConsoleTextAttribute(handle, FOREGROUND_INTENSITY | FOREGROUND_RED);
printf(" | 1.复利计算 |\n");
SetConsoleTextAttribute(handle, FOREGROUND_INTENSITY | FOREGROUND_GREEN);
printf(" | 2.单利计算 |\n");
SetConsoleTextAttribute(handle, FOREGROUND_INTENSITY | FOREGROUND_RED | FOREGROUND_GREEN);
printf(" | 3.养老金计算 |\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_RED | FOREGROUND_BLUE);
printf(" | 4.股票计算 |\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_GREEN | FOREGROUND_BLUE);
printf(" | 5.投资计算 |\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_RED | FOREGROUND_GREEN | FOREGROUND_BLUE);
printf(" | 6.定额定投收益计算 |\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_BLUE);
printf(" | 7.贷款 |\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_RED | FOREGROUND_GREEN | FOREGROUND_BLUE);
printf(" --------------------------------------\n");
printf(" \n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),BACKGROUND_INTENSITY |BACKGROUND_INTENSITY);
printf("请根据数字选择你需要的功能(0~7)\n");
SetConsoleTextAttribute(GetStdHandle(STD_OUTPUT_HANDLE),FOREGROUND_INTENSITY |FOREGROUND_RED | FOREGROUND_GREEN | FOREGROUND_BLUE);
scanf("%d",&num);
switch(num)
{
case 0:
clean();
break;
case 1:
printf("\n");
fuli();
save();
break;
case 2:
printf("\n");
danli();
save1();
break;
case 3:
printf("\n");
fanxiang();
save2();
break;
case 4:
printf("\n");
gupiao();
save3();
break;
case 5:
printf("\n");
touzi();
save4();
break;
case 6:
printf("\n");
ligunli();
break;
case 7:
printf("\n");
daikuan();
save6();
break;
}
}
}

动态显示大致是与其颜色对应的选项.
https://github.com/zzzzzz1234/Huazy/blob/master/fuli8.c